Gibson Les Paul Custom 70s Electric Guitar - Buttercream Top FADE2BLACK2025 The most important difference inThe Les Paul Custom was first introduced in 1953 as an upscale version of the Les Paul model. The model was requested by Les Paul himself, who wanted a black version of the Les Paul guitar that looked like a tuxedo. In 1961, the single cutaway Les Paul Custom was discontinued in favor of a new double cutaway model that would later become known as the SG Custom, and the original single cutaway model was reintroduced in 1968.
